The paths in the village were not easy to travel, especially the path to Xiao Liulang and Gu Jiao’s house. There were too many potholes, and it was easy for the wheels to get caught.

The mule cart stopped at the village entrance.

After Xiao Liulang got his footing, he turned around and glanced at Gu Jiao.

Gu Jiao jumped out of the carriage lightly and carried the basket on her back.

Xiao Liulang looked away and said to his classmate, “You should go back. You don’t have to send me home.”

It was indeed late, and the coachman was getting impatient.

His classmate said, “Alright, then I’m leaving. Don’t forget about the exam in three days. The academy isn’t on holiday that day, so I won’t be picking you up. Remember to go yourself.”

“Okay.” Xiao Liulang nodded mildly and took his bag.

It was not easy to walk at night, and they did not have a lantern, so Gu Jiao did not move and waited silently for Xiao Liulang at the side.

His classmate glanced at her coldly and pulled Xiao Liulang further away. He whispered, “Brother Xiao, in three days if you do well and pass the exam, you’ll be able to stay at the academy! You won’t have to suffer under this evil woman anymore! Don’t worry about the treatment for your leg, I’ll continue to ask about Doctor Zhang. Oh, and eat the osmanthus cake yourself. Don’t let that evil woman take advantage of you!”

When Gu Jiao walked back from the market with the basket on her back, she was covered in sweat, but it had all dried while they were on the cart. Her reddened face was pale from the cold, and it was a little eye-catching under the moonlight.

Xiao Liulang glanced at her from the corner of his eye. His classmate wanted to say more, but he was interrupted by Xiao Liulang. “Got it. You should go back.”

His classmate continued to flap his mouth, but Xiao Liulang ignored him. Grabbing his bag with one hand and holding his walking stick with the other, he turned around and headed home.

Gu Jiao followed behind him.

Gu Jiao maintained the right distance from him, so as not to let him feel that she was too close, but still close enough that she could support him in time if he tripped.

However, Xiao Liulang was very familiar with this road. Nothing happened along the way home.

It was already dark, and all the households had closed their doors. Only Xue Ningxiang came out to pour away the bathwater, and she was frozen at the door for a while.

“Ah Xiang, why aren’t you coming in? What are you looking at?”

In the room, Xue Ningxiang’s mother-in-law was laying on the bed as she asked in a hoarse voice.

Xue Ningxiang blinked in a daze and replied, “No, it’s nothing.”

She must have been mistaken.?Why would Xiao Liulang be with that fool? They might be married, but they’re worse enemies than most.

At the Gu family’s old residence.

Today, it was the eldest branch’s turn to cook. Madam Zhou and her daughter, Gu Yue’e, carried the piping hot food to the central room and set the dishes.

In the Gu family, women did not eat at the table. Only Old Master Gu, his eldest son Gu Changhai, his second son Gu Changlu, and his three grandchildren were at the table.

Old Madam Wu brought her two daughters-in-law and granddaughter, Gu Yue’e, to the kitchen to eat.

As a junior officer, Old Master Gu fared far better than the villagers who only knew how to tend their fields. Everyone else could count on their hands the number of times they saw meat in a year, but the Gu family could afford to eat meat twice a month.

Today was one of the days they had meat.

There was pork belly stewed with cabbage, and even the soup emitted a rich, fatty fragrance.

However, there was not much pork belly; there was barely enough even if each of them only had a couple pieces.

After Gu Changhai and Gu Changlu each picked up a piece, under their father’s dignified presence they did not dare to have any more designs on the meat. They turned around, helping themselves to the pickled vegetables.

Old Master Gu did not eat much either, only having a small piece himself. He also picked medium-sized pieces for Gu Xiaoshun and Gu Ershun, then gave the rest to Gu Dashun.

Gu Xiaoshun counted carefully. There were a total of five pieces, and all of them were big pieces even!

“Why can he have so many pieces?” Gu Xiaoshun muttered bitterly as he ate.

Gu Ershun said softly, “That’s because Eldest Brother is a scholar. We’re counting on Eldest Brother to stand up for us.”

When he said this, however, he could not help but glance at the meat in Gu Dashun’s bowl.

He craved it.

He really craved for it.

However, he was already used to this sort of differential treatment.

There were many men in the family, but only their eldest brother was any good at studying. This year, their eldest brother even passed the admission exam for the county school and became an official scholar, an academic achievement greater than his grandfather’s.

“Tsk.” Gu Xiaoshun rolled his eyes. “My brother-in-law is also a scholar. Why don’t I see you guys asking him to eat more meat?”

“How is that the same? Big Brother has already been admitted to the county school. He doesn’t even compare to Big Brother.”

“My brother-in-law just didn’t take the exam.”

The two brothers were still continuing to argue when Old Master Gu slammed his chopsticks on the table; the two of them instantly clammed up.

When the old master was angry, not just his three grandchildren, even Gu Changhai and Gu Changlu would be a little frightened.

The house was eerily silent.

“Ershun, have you read the book I gave you? I made some annotations on it. Take a look, and ask me if you don’t understand something.”

It was Gu Dashun who was speaking.

He was the only one who dared to speak when the old man was angry.

His voice was clear and his tone was calm. Neither too fast nor too slow, he really carried himself with the demeanor of a scholar.

He was the treasured apple in Old Master Gu’s eye—the Old Master’s anger quickly dissipated.

Flattered, Gu Ershun smiled. “Okay. Thanks, Big Brother!”

Back then, Old Master Gu taught all three of his grandsons, but only Gu Dashun could pass the examinations. Eventually, Old Master Gu was no longer able to teach him, so he sent Gu Dashun to a private school in town.

The private school was too expensive, so the Gu family could only afford for their most outstanding grandson to be admitted.

Gu Ershun dreamed of being like Gu Dashun.

Old Master Gu said in a dignified manner, “Don’t disturb your big brother these few days. He has an exam to take.”

Gu Ershun nodded respectfully. “Got it, Grandpa.”

Gu Xiaoshun did not want to stay any longer. He finished his meal in a few bites and left.

He wanted to leave, but he could not leave through the front door of the central room, nor the back door of the kitchen. Madam Wu was not as easy to deal with as the old man.

Gu Xiaoshun decided to climb over the wall.

However, he had only climbed halfway when Madam Liu caught him. “Gu Xiaoshun! Get down!”

Madam Liu dragged Gu Xiaoshun down.

Madam Liu slapped his head and scolded in a low voice, “Your grandparents are all here. Are you tired of living?”

“Don’t hit my head!” Gu Xiaoshun said impatiently.

“It’s already so late. Where are you going out to?”

“My sister hasn’t been here for a day. I want to see how she’s doing.”

Madam Liu snorted. “It’s good that she’s not here. See how she’s doing? She’s already married, yet she still goes to her parents’ house every day. How shameless!”

Gu Xiaoshun pursed his lips and said, “That’s not what Third Uncle and Third Aunt said before they passed away. Grandpa and Grandma promised Third Aunt that for Sister they would find someone to marry in, so brother-in-law married into the Gu family, and Sister’s still a member of our family.”

Madam Liu could not argue against him, and simply pinched him hard.

Gu Ershun was obedient but useless. Gu Xiaoshun was neither obedient nor useful. She had given birth to her two sons in vain!

Gu Jiao bought rice and noodles at the market. She did not expect Xiao Liulang to have bought something as well, a few plain steamed buns.

Gu Jiao went to the kitchen to heat up the steamed buns.

It was Xiao Liulang who prepared the fire.

Gu Jiao did not argue.

When she went out, the wound on her wrist was not serious. However, at the market she did someone to cause her wound to tear. Serendipitously, she felt the house was not a safe place to leave it, so she had brought the medicine box with her and bandaged it on the spot.

Neither of them made any mention of the three cornmeal buns from the morning. Xiao Liulang did not explain, and Gu Jiao did not question him.

“Let’s eat here. It’s warm,” Gu Jiao said. She was freezing, and she was even shivering.

Xiao Liulang hesitated for a moment before nodding and sitting down on the stool beside Gu Jiao.

This was the first time the two of them were so close. They were so close that he could clearly see the birthmark on the side of Gu Jiao’s face as he sat on her left.

In the past, Gu Jiao had always covered herself with thick makeup, but now, she was bare-faced and did not hide anything.

The corners of Xiao Liulang’s beautiful lips twitched, but he did not say anything.

Just like how she would not ask about him, he would not ask her either.

They were two completely unrelated people to begin with, so there was no need for them to have a deeper relationship.

The white steamed buns were pretty bland, but Gu Jiao had been famished for the entire day, so she was not picky about it.

Gu Jiao choked and went to get a drink of water. When she returned, Xiao Liulang was no longer there, and a pouch was left on the small stool.

Gu Jiao opened it.

It was osmanthus cake.
